Transaction 6f26219d79bdfb493bdcc404ece0c51886b92218f90c24f8416563e1fecede13
1 Input
1 Output
-
6f26219d79bdfb493bdcc404ece0c51886b92218f90c24f8416563e1fecede13:0
- value
- 2907249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fc5350c6d2e4e9bedc6ea9fb4bcaa3095e87eca OP_EQUAL
- address
- 3GFocF2jdrtzhyM9TPwAMtpSA1pRNAEk8U